通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

硬件开发买什么配置电脑

硬件开发买什么配置电脑

硬件开发需要的电脑配置主要包括:强大的CPU、大容量内存、高性能显卡、快速的硬盘、稳定的电源和合适的显示器。

其中,强大的CPU是必不可少的。因为硬件开发需要进行大量的模拟和测试,这就需要CPU有强大的处理能力。而且,硬件开发还会涉及到一些复杂的算法和大数据处理,这也需要CPU有足够的计算能力。因此,对于硬件开发者来说,选择一款高性能的CPU是非常必要的。

一、CPU的选择

对于硬件开发者来说,CPU是电脑中最重要的部件之一。CPU的性能将直接影响到硬件开发的效率。目前市面上的CPU主要有Intel和AMD两大品牌。其中,Intel的i7和i9系列以及AMD的Ryzen系列都是非常不错的选择。

强大的CPU可以有效地提高硬件开发的效率。例如,当进行大规模集成电路设计或者复杂的算法模拟时,高性能的CPU可以大大缩短计算时间,从而提高工作效率。

二、内存的选择

硬件开发对内存的需求也非常大。大容量的内存可以让开发者同时运行多个开发工具,而不会出现卡顿或者响应慢的情况。对于硬件开发者来说,一般推荐的内存容量是16GB或者更高。

对于内存来说,除了容量之外,速度也是非常重要的。DDR4和DDR5的内存相比较,DDR5的速度更快,对于需要进行大量计算和数据处理的硬件开发来说,选择DDR5内存是更好的选择。

三、显卡的选择

虽然硬件开发并不像游戏开发那样对显卡有极高的需求,但是高性能的显卡仍然可以提高硬件开发的效率。例如,当进行硬件模拟或者3D建模时,高性能的显卡可以提供更流畅的体验。

目前,NVIDIA和AMD的显卡都是非常不错的选择。其中,NVIDIA的Quadro系列和AMD的Radeon Pro系列都是专为专业工作负载设计的,可以提供非常好的性能。

四、硬盘的选择

硬盘的选择主要取决于硬件开发者的需求。如果需要存储大量的数据,那么选择大容量的硬盘是必要的。而如果对速度有较高的要求,那么可以选择SSD硬盘。

对于硬件开发者来说,推荐使用SSD硬盘。因为SSD硬盘的读写速度远高于传统的HDD硬盘,可以大大提高开发效率。

五、电源和显示器的选择

稳定的电源是保证电脑正常运行的重要条件。一款高质量的电源可以提供稳定的电压和电流,防止电脑因为电源问题而出现故障。

显示器的选择主要取决于硬件开发者的需求。如果需要进行高精度的图像处理或者3D建模,那么选择一款高分辨率的显示器是非常必要的。而如果主要进行代码开发,那么选择一款舒适的显示器就足够了。

总结,硬件开发需要的电脑配置主要包括强大的CPU、大容量内存、高性能显卡、快速的硬盘、稳定的电源和合适的显示器。选择合适的配置,可以大大提高硬件开发的效率,提高工作质量。

相关问答FAQs:

Q1: 如何选择适合硬件开发的电脑配置?
A1: 为了适应硬件开发的需求,您应该选择具有高性能的电脑配置。首先,您可以考虑购买一台配备强大的处理器和大容量内存的电脑,以确保您能够处理复杂的任务和运行多个程序。其次,选择一台具备高级图形处理能力的显卡,以便您可以进行3D建模和渲染等图形相关的工作。此外,选购一个大容量的硬盘或SSD来存储您的项目文件和数据也是非常重要的。

Q2: 如何平衡硬件开发电脑的性能和成本?
A2: 在购买硬件开发电脑时,我们需要在性能和成本之间取得平衡。首先,可以选择性价比较高的品牌和型号,比如通过查看用户评价和专家推荐来选择可靠的品牌。其次,可以根据自己的实际需求来选择适当的配置,不需要追求过高的性能,以免浪费资源。最后,可以考虑购买二手设备或者等待促销活动,以节省成本。

Q3: 软件开发和硬件开发所需的电脑配置有什么区别?
A3: 软件开发和硬件开发在电脑配置上有一些不同之处。首先,在处理器选择上,软件开发通常更加注重多线程性能,而硬件开发则更关注单线程性能。其次,软件开发对内存需求较高,而硬件开发对图形处理能力和存储容量有更高要求。此外,软件开发通常需要更好的键盘和鼠标输入设备,而硬件开发可能需要更多的接口和扩展插槽来连接外部设备和传感器。

相关文章